Enabling automated review request emails

Set up automatic post-purchase emails that invite customers to leave reviews — the easiest way to grow your review count on autopilot.

3 min read

1How automated emails work

After a customer's order is fulfilled (shipped), Reviewifyd waits for the delay period you set, then sends a branded email asking for a review. The customer clicks a star rating in the email and is taken to a pre-filled review form.

2Enabling the feature

To turn on automated review requests:

  1. 1Go to Reviewifyd dashboard → Settings → Email Requests.
  2. 2Toggle 'Automated review requests' to ON.
  3. 3Set your send delay (default: 7 days after fulfillment).
  4. 4Click 'Save changes'.
⚠️

Emails are sent from Shopify's transactional email infrastructure. Make sure your store's sender email is verified in Shopify admin → Settings → Notifications.

3Choosing the right send delay

The ideal delay depends on your shipping times. A good rule of thumb:

  1. 1Standard shipping (5–10 days): set delay to 12–14 days.
  2. 2Express shipping (1–3 days): set delay to 5–7 days.
  3. 3Digital products: set delay to 1–2 days.
💡

Emails sent too early (before the product arrives) get ignored. Emails sent too late lose momentum. Optimize your delay after the first 30 days by checking your open rate in the Email Stats section.

4Verifying emails are sending

After enabling, go to Email → Activity Log. Every sent email appears here with its status: Sent, Opened, Clicked, or Review Submitted. If emails show 'Failed', verify your sender email in Shopify admin.
